ICD-10-CMLaceration without foreign body, unspecified thigh, initial encounter
This code signifies a cut or tear in the skin and underlying tissues of the thigh that does not involve any foreign material embedded in the wound. The specific location on the thigh is not documented, and this is the first time the patient is receiving care for this particular injury.
This code is appropriate for documenting an acute, uncomplicated laceration of the thigh where the exact anatomical site (e.g., anterior, posterior, medial) is not specified in the medical record. It is used for the initial treatment of such an injury, such as wound cleaning, closure, or initial assessment in an emergency department.
